Retail Team Lead- Department: Field Operations
Direct Reporting Line: Store Manager
Subsidiary/Country: Canada
Location:
- GSMS Grade: P3
Personnel Managed: Yes- Purpose:
- Act in a leadership capacity to support the sales, profitability, and operational goals for the store by guiding the hourly associates in the day-to-day procedures to best drive the store objectives.- Key Responsibilities:
- In conjunction with, or in the absence of management staff, guide the daily operations of the store and activities of hourly associates to accomplish excellent customer service and to maximize sales.
- Provide positive reinforcement to hourly associates to promote a high level of momentum and to achieve the optimal results and growth of the staff.
- Conducts one-on-one and/or small group training presentations for Sales Associates on product knowledge, store activities, job duties, and established policies and procedures.
- Perform or assist in the completion of all documentation associated with applicants and new hires.
- Assist management staff to display merchandise such as clothes, footwear and accessories in windows, showcases, and on the sales floor to attract attention and promote sales.
- Effectively utilize customer service, training, educational tools, and communication to develop staff in relation to division goals.
- Originate displays of merchandise or follow suggestions or schedules provided by the store management team.
- Assist with staffing and labor cost control standards and effectively maintain same.
- Attain proficiency with the point of sale system by acquiring system utilization skills. Ensure integrity is maintained through attention to policy and procedure.
- Completes any regular sales transactions involving cash, credit, checks, etc.
- Involved indirectly with ticketing of products as well as checking paperwork against items received.
- Assists in product flow from stockroom to sales floor on a fill in basis.
- Monitors and maintains sales floor fill - in process.
- Communicates the product levels and assortments with management.
- Communicates progress on assigned projects such as floor change outs, processing shipments, sales/markdown set-ups.
- Performs sales, customer service, merchandising within section, special order, cashiering, stock location, and related store up keeping support duties in order to maintain needed staff coverage and to lead by example.
- Directs the performance of store up keeping duties.
- Listen to customer complaints, examine returned merchandise, and resolve problems to restore and promote good public relations.
- Ensures the highest level of adidas service is given to each customer.
- Uses selling techniques such as add on sales and describing technical information to customers to enhance salesmanship and reach store and position sales goals. Uses these techniques to train other employees.
- Other duties as assigned by the Store Manager
- Knowledge Skills and Abilities:
- Must possess and consistently exhibit the competencies relative to the position.
- Ability to deal with problems involving several concrete variables in standardized situations.
- Ability to use MS Word, Excel, Outlook, and a point of sale system.
- Ability to exercise good judgment and decision making skills.
- Ability to add, subtract, multiply, and divide in all units of measure, using whole numbers, common fractions, and decimals.
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
- Ability to work a varied schedule including weekends, evenings and statutory holidays. Also able to work overtime hours during peak sales periods which include, but are not limited to, Thanksgiving, Christmas, Easter, Mother's Day, Father's Day, and Back-to-School.
- While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to talk or hear. The employee frequently is required to stand; walk; use hands to finger, handle, or feel; and reach with hands and arms. The employee is occasionally required to sit; climb or balance; and stoop, kneel, crouch, or crawl. The employee must frequently lift and/or move up to 12 kg and occasionally lift and/or move up to 34 kg.
- Schedule flexibility is mandatory, as this position calls for evening, weekend, and holiday work.
- Qualifications:
